Thomas Brown Estates are delighted to present this rare opportunity to acquire a detached three double bedroom, two bathroom family home on the highly sought after Goddington Lane in South Orpington. Offered to the market with no onward chain, this attractive property occupies a generous mature plot and offers exceptional scope to extend and enhance, subject to the necessary planning permissions.
Ideally positioned within walking distance of Orpington and Chelsfield stations, Orpington High Street, and the renowned St Olaves Grammar School, the property enjoys a prime location that is highly desirable for families and commuters alike.
The accommodation comprises an entrance porch leading into a welcoming hallway, an extended living room with views over the rear garden, a separate dining room with feature bay window, fitted kitchen, utility area, and a ground floor shower room.
Upstairs, the property offers three well-proportioned double bedrooms, a family bathroom, and separate WC.
Outside, the home boasts a beautifully secluded and mature rear garden measuring approximately 115', providing an excellent space for family enjoyment and future landscaping. To the front, there is a garage and a driveway offering off street parking for several vehicles.
With many neighbouring properties having been significantly extended, this home presents an outstanding opportunity to create a substantial family residence, subject to planning permission.
